Finca Villacreces Pruno 2023

Pruno grew to become Finca Villacreces' international crowd favorite and is one of the best-known wines from Ribera del Duero's Golden Mile. The 2023 vintage combines juicy fruit and fresh tension with the powerful, polished structure you expect from this origin.

Vineyards and Region

The grapes come from the winery's own vineyards around Quintanilla de Onésimo, in the heart of the most prestigious part of Ribera del Duero.

  • Location / Origin: Finca Villacreces is located on a meander of the Duero, in Ribera del Duero's Golden Mile. The vineyards are surrounded by a 200-year-old pine forest that creates a unique microclimate around the parcels.
  • Altitude: The vines grow at about 700 m above sea level. The large temperature differences between warm days and cool nights support even ripening and help the grapes retain their natural acidity.
  • Soil: The parcels vary from very sandy soil near the forest to stony soils with alluvial pebbles from the Duero. These poor, well-draining soils limit natural yields and produce concentrated fruit.
  • Vineyard Management: The winery's own vineyards are divided into different parcels and are cared for according to integrated viticulture principles. Production remains limited to less than 2 kg of grapes per vine, with average yields around 4000 kg per hectare.

Vinification and Aging

A double selection and precisely adjusted wood aging give Pruno its combination of ripe fruit, structure, and suppleness.

  • Harvest & Selection: The grapes are hand-picked into small 15 kg crates. This is followed by a double sorting round where both the entire bunches and individual grapes are checked.
  • Fermentation: Alcoholic fermentation takes place in stainless steel tanks with regular cap immersion. Malolactic fermentation occurs partly in stainless steel and partly in wooden barrels, which rounds off the acidity and builds extra texture.
  • Wood Aging: The wine ages for 10 months in second- and third-year barrels of 75% French and 25% American oak. The French wood brings refinement and spice, while the American oak further supports the round, inviting style.
  • Alcohol Content: At 14.5% alcohol, the 2023 vintage possesses sufficient power and volume, while the juicy fruit and fresh acidity provide an energetic balance.

Grape Composition

The blend combines the local strength of Tempranillo with small percentages of international grape varieties.

  • 94% Tempranillo – Ribera del Duero: Tempranillo forms the backbone and brings ripe cherry fruit, volume, and a firm, fine-grained tannin structure.
  • 4% Cabernet Sauvignon – Ribera del Duero: Cabernet Sauvignon adds extra grip, dark fruit notes, and a spicy dimension to the blend.
  • 2% Merlot – Ribera del Duero: Merlot adds suppleness and roundness, making the wine particularly inviting to drink even when young.

Tasting Notes and Serving Suggestions

Intense cherry red with a purple rim and a concentrated nose of cherries, blueberry, toasted cocoa, and coffee caramel. The taste is fleshy and juicy, with ripe tannins, dark chocolate, and a balsamic hint of black licorice. The finish is long, spicy, and fruit-driven.

  • Serving Temperature: Serve this Ribera del Duero at 16–18 °C, so that the fruit remains vibrant and the cocoa, spice, and wood notes can fully unfold.
  • Dishes: Pair it with grilled beef, lamb chops, slow-cooked pork, game dishes, mushroom risotto, or hearty Spanish charcuterie.

More Information about Finca Villacreces

The history of the estate dates back to 1350, when the Franciscan monk Pedro de Villacreces settled here and planted a small vineyard. Centuries later, Peter Sisseck used part of the cellar and vineyards for the production of Flor de Pingus. Gonzalo and Lalo Antón took over the estate in 2004, restored the vineyards, and reopened the bodega in 2007 as part of Artevino Family Wineries.
